2. History of the San Francesco Complex

The San Francesco complex, formed by the church and the ancient Franciscan convent, is one of the most important places in the religious and artistic history of Gerace, as well as one of the oldest Franciscan settlements in Calabria. The complex was built in 1252 in the north-west area of the village, near Piazza delle Tre Chiese. The church rests on the ruins of an earlier Romanesque building, while the convent was founded in the early 13th century when the village was considered one of the most important religious and administrative centres in southern Italy. Over the centuries, the complex was extended and transformed several times: between the 17th and 18th centuries, side chapels and Baroque elements were added, while the convent was enriched with new spaces dedicated to monastic life and hospitality. In 1783, a devastating earthquake affected the village, leaving several buildings beyond repair and also severely damaging the complex. In spite of everything, the structure retained many of its original features but soon lost much of its splendour. Its decline can be attributed to the abandonment of the convent by the friars during the French occupation in 1806 and the subsequent suppression of religious orders. Moreover, in order to prevent the confiscation of its assets, the friars took them away, depriving the church of its rich artistic heritage. Subsequently, the complex had various uses: it was a prison until 1897, when it became a mill, an oil mill and the site of civil dwellings. The 1908 earthquake further contributed to the deterioration of the monument, which, however, thanks to the work of the Superintendency of Calabria, was restored starting in 1951, thus recovering a tangible testimony to the wealth of Calabria's religious heritage.
